David Stockman sits down with Albert Lu at the 2018 Sprott Natural Resources Symposium in Vancouver. Stockman considers the "temporary prosperity" that the world economy is experiencing and what beckons on the horizon amid the "omnipotent central banking."
David Stockman is a former Republican congressman from Michigan and was President Reagan's budget director from 1981 to 1985. After leaving the White House, Stockman became a managing director at Salomon Brothers, and he later founded a private equity fund. David is the founder of David Stockman's Contra Corner, and he is the author of The Great Deformation: The Corruption of Capitalism in America and Trumped! A Nation on the Brink of Ruin... And How to Bring It Back.
